A new book which, essentially, arose from the author s inability as an instructor to find a textbook that fully met her needs or the needs of her students! Overly comprehensive texts generate blank faces and overly concise texts fail to fully meet the need for an effective depth of learning. This new text achieves a great balance between the depth of coverage and readability, but balance is not the only reason this book is needed. Reflecting the movement toward evidence based practice in audiology and speech-language pathology, the author has ensured that the concepts associated with evidence based practice are integrated throughout the various chapters (not just added as a separate chapter or course segment). Also included are features that help students in being more active in learning the material. Each chapter has a set of review questions or case scenarios that can be used as homework, as probe questions in class, or as group activities. Importantly, the author has included lists of supplemental readings from the research literature in the field.
